Reference: CVE-2018-12027
Title: Phusion Passenger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or Vulnerability
Overview:

An Insecure Permissions vulnerability in SpawningKit in Phusion Passenger 5.3.x before 5.3.2 causes information disclosure in the following situation: given a Passenger-spawned application process that reports that it listens on a certain Unix domain socket if any of the parent directories of said socket are writable by a normal user that is not the application39s user then that non-application user can swap that directory with something else resulting in traffic being redirected to a non-application user39s process through an alternative Unix domain socket.
